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

BrazilThe property is on a dead-end, the end of the street being a wall that's shared with the police station, so mind the fact that you have to reverse every time you park. The police station is a bit reassuring in terms of safety, but it comes with random sirens at some times in the morning (especially Friday-Saturday). I always sleep with earplugs, but some people don't, so I always mention this kind of stuff to warn the light sleepers. Also, the neighbor next door, an Irish guy, is SUPER loud. He's got some family issues (I know because I basically shared the whole conversation with him through the wall at 1:30 in the morning). I also noticed cars coming in and out at random times and he would go out as well and talk very briefly with people. This is a clear indication of some dodgy activities and I'm pretty sure everyone knows what I mean. That said, he interacted with me a few times when I'd go in or out and was very polite. About the house itself, could be cleaner. Like, I lifted the toilet seat and it had lots of brown stains. Come on... Had to clean the toilet as soon as I arrived... The bin cover was moldy and I had to wash EVERY SINGLE UTENSIL. Seriously. There wasn't a single clean fork on sight. Also every single pan and pot, because I cook a lot. I know this is the guest's responsibility, but it's the property manager's responsibility to check if things are actually clean. Also... The back "garden", was just a place to throw old stuff in. Cigarette butts by the drain and an old plastic bag filled with rubbish. No chairs, no table. I also really missed a place to have a meal or work. There's no desk or comfy chairs. If I owned this place I'd get rid of the wall in the living room, build a counter and put some chairs there and increase the space of the flat. Anyway. I travel A LOT for work, so I like to leave detailed reviews because you never know what people's needs are.
The property was actually OK. Check-in was super smooth, keys in a lockbox, got the code on the day of arrival through Booking. There are two bedrooms upstairs with two single beds in each one of them. Bathroom, kitchen and separate living room downstairs. Location is fair, the Wirral is a small area and quite easy to go around, you wouldn't be too far from anything here really. Comfy beds and good shower. I appreciated the fact that the sheets were clean and that there was a coffee machine with pods, basic kitchen utensils and a washing machine with detergent provided. Leaving shower gel and shampoo from what I assume the past guests is always welcome, same with little kitchen things (there was no salt tho...). Now for the negatives.
